Introduction
Gear racks for greenhouses are linear tracks with teeth along their length that are used in greenhouse systems to facilitate the movement of greenhouse accessories, such as curtains or shading systems.

Working Principles

Gear Rack Installation
Proper installation of gear racks is essential for their optimal performance. The racks need to be securely mounted and aligned to ensure smooth engagement with the motor and pinion gear.
Motor and Pinion Gear
Motor and pinion gear are responsible for driving the gear rack and controlling the movement of greenhouse accessories. They work together to ensure precise and controlled operation.
Gear Rack Engagement
The engagement between the gear rack and the motor/pinion gear is crucial for the efficient and reliable movement of greenhouse accessories. Proper engagement ensures smooth operation and prevents any disruptions.
Component Control
Various components, such as sensors and control systems, are used to monitor and control the movement of greenhouse accessories. These components work in tandem with the gear rack to ensure accurate and timely adjustments.
Precise and Controlled Operation
Through the coordination of all the working principles mentioned above, gear racks for greenhouses enable precise and controlled operation of greenhouse accessories, ensuring optimal conditions for crop growth.
Installation and Maintenance

Installation
1. Prepare the Mounting Surface: Ensure that the mounting surface is clean and level to provide a solid foundation for the gear rack installation.
2. Positioning: Accurately position the gear rack along the desired installation path, ensuring proper alignment and engagement.
3. Secure Mounting: Securely mount the gear rack using appropriate fasteners, ensuring stability and preventing any movement during operation.
4. Connection to Motor or Drive System: Connect the gear rack to the motor or drive system, ensuring proper alignment and smooth power transmission.

Maintenance
1. Regular Inspection: Regularly inspect the gear rack for any signs of wear, damage, or misalignment. Address any issues promptly to ensure optimal performance.
2. Lubrication: Apply lubrication to the gear rack periodically to reduce friction and prevent premature wear. Use a lubricant suitable for the specific gear rack material.
3. Cleaning: Keep the gear rack clean by removing any dirt, debris, or residue that may accumulate over time. This helps maintain smooth operation and prevents damage.
4. Adjustment: Periodically check and adjust the gear rack’s alignment and engagement with the motor or pinion gear to ensure optimal performance.
5. Replacement: If the gear rack shows significant signs of wear or damage, consider replacing it to maintain the efficiency and reliability of the greenhouse system.
Selecting the Right Gear Rack for Greenhouse

Load Capacity
Consider the maximum load that the gear rack needs to support to ensure it can handle the weight of the greenhouse accessories.
Material
Choose a gear rack made from high-quality materials that offer durability, corrosion resistance, and long-lasting performance in greenhouse environments.
Module/Pitch
Select the appropriate module/pitch size based on the specific requirements of the greenhouse system, considering factors such as the desired speed and precision of movement.
Length
Determine the required length of the gear rack based on the dimensions of the greenhouse and the distance that the accessories need to traverse.
Compatibility
Ensure that the gear rack is compatible with the motor or drive system used in the greenhouse, considering factors such as gear ratio and power transmission capabilities.
Noise Reduction
Choose a gear rack that incorporates noise reduction features to minimize any disruptive noise generated during operation, creating a quieter and more pleasant greenhouse environment.
Budget
Consider the budget constraints when selecting a gear rack, ensuring that it provides a balance between cost-effectiveness and the desired performance.
